Early Origins of the De la fayet family

The surname De la fayet was first found in Auvergne, a historic province in south central France where this distinguished family held a family seat since ancient times.

De la fayet Spelling Variations

Spelling variations of this family name include: Fayet, Fayettes, Fayette, Lafayet, Delafayet, Lafayette, La Fauyet, La Fayets, La Fayettes, De La Fayettes, Des Fayettes and many more.

Early Notables of the De la fayet family

Notable amongst the family was

  • Louise Angélique Motier de la Fayette (1618-1665), French courtier and close friend of King Louis XIII
  • Marie-Madeleine Pioche de La Vergne, Comtesse de La Fayette (1634-1693), known as Madame de La Fayette, a French author of La Princesse de Clèves
